- The distance between Waynesboro, Ms, Usa and Lake Rotoiti, New Zealand is approximately 12,930 km or 8,035 mi.
- To reach Waynesboro, Ms in this distance one would set out from Lake Rotoiti bearing 69.4° or ENE and follow the great circles arc to approach Waynesboro, Ms bearing 55.4° or NE .
- Waynesboro, Ms has a humid subtropical climate (Cfa) whereas Lake Rotoiti has a marine west coast climate (Cfb).
- Waynesboro, Ms is in or near the subtropical moist forest biome whereas Lake Rotoiti is in or near the cool temperate steppe biome.
- The annual mean temperature is 9.2 °C (16.6°F) warmer.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 7.2 °C (13°F) more in Waynesboro, Ms. The continentality subtype is semicontinental as opposed to truly oceanic.
- Total annual precipitation averages 135 mm (5.3 in) less which is equivalent to 135 l/m² (3.31 US gal/ft²) or 1,350,000 l/ha (144,324 US gal/ac) less. About 1 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 10.5° higher in Waynesboro, Ms than in Lake Rotoiti.
